LPG prices still too high–DOE chief
Written by staff   
Tuesday, 30 November 1999 00:00
MANILA, Philippines—Prices of liquefied petroleum gas in the country are still too high despite the price cuts made by oil firms and dealers, according to Energy Secretary Angelo Reyes.
